jockeys
US /ˈdʒɑː.kiz/
UK /ˈdʒɒk.iz/
Noun
riders in horse races, especially as a profession
Example:
•
The jockeys prepared their horses for the big race.
•
Many young people dream of becoming professional jockeys.
Verb
to handle or manage something skillfully or cunningly
Example:
•
He had to jockey for position to get the best view of the stage.
•
The politician tried to jockey his opponent out of the race.
